In New York City’s Flatiron District, Lucky, newly arrived from Ghana, hocks fake designer products out of back rooms with his partner, Levon. Modestly successful in their gray market endeavors, the duo are satisfied. Lucky’s cheerful life takes an unexpected turn, however, when his toddler son comes to live with him. Now, burdened with the responsibility of fathering a child, Lucky must readapt to the pressures of life as a petty criminal.

Set over a single early-1960s summer in one of Sarajevo’s mahalas, the plot follows the fortunes of a school boy nicknamed Dino. Simultaneous to being enthralled with a life that flashes before his eyes and ears in the local cinema and youth centre (where, among other things, he watches Alessandro Blasetti’s Europa di notte and listens to Adriano Celentano’s 24 Mila Baci), Dino gets a taste of the world inhabited by local thugs and petty criminals. However, when he is rewarded via a liaison for providing a hiding place for prostitute “Dolly Bell”, his world is turned upside down as he falls in love with her.
Teen angst, incest, and… what exactly is buried in the basement? This macabre, compellingly bizarro coming-of-age tale charts the strange goings-on within a family living in an isolated, rubble-strewn no-man’s land. One day, as 15-year-old Jack masturbates, his father drops dead. Mother follows shortly thereafter. Rather than tell anyone, Jack and older sister Julie assume the roles of father and mother to their two younger siblings—but take things to the extreme. Based on Ian McEwan’s gothic novel, this should-be cult classic is a gripping, wonderfully weird portrait of nontraditional family values.
